Grenzlandweg is 11.6 km long.
At an average walking pace, Grenzlandweg takes approximately 2h 53min to complete.
Yes, Grenzlandweg is a round walk that starts and finishes at the same point — no return transport needed.
Grenzlandweg starts near coordinates 48.5974, 14.5301.
Grenzlandweg is a moderate hike suitable for walkers with a basic level of fitness.
Grenzlandweg is maintained and managed by Tourismuskern Windhaag b. Freistadt.
